In a city swarming with traffic, it is often a lot wiser to rely on bicycles to carry you to your destination quickly. However, at the same time, it may not be all that feasible to have a bike in a metropolis, given the fact that it is extremely easy for someone to steal away your bike, despite all those fancy locks.


Social Bicycles has set its bicycles with built-in GPS which, it has been recently announced, will be making use of AT&T’s wireless network. The wireless connectivity will ensure that the bike doesn’t get stolen somewhere in the city and that its location is known at all times. (more…)
